The Effects of Different Purifying Methods on the Chemical Properties, in Vitro Anti-Tumor and Immunomodulatory Activities of Abrus cantoniensis Polysaccharide Fractions

Abstract: Abrus cantoniensis (Hance) is a popular Chinese vegetable consumed as a beverage, soup or folk medicine. To fully exploit the potential of the polysaccharide in Abrus cantoniensis, nine polysaccharide fractions of Abrus cantoniensis were isolated and purified (AP-AOH30-1, AP-AOH30-2, AP-AOH80-1, AP-AOH80-2, AP-ACl-1, AP-ACl-2, AP-ACl-3, AP-H and AP-L). “…The AFM is a powerful technique of structure characterization analysis, which can be used to observe the morphology and size of macromolecular chains in samples under room temperature and pressure. AFM has gradually become a vital approach to explore the structures of biological macromolecules, such as polysaccharides and DNA ( 34 ). As is shown in Figures 3B,C , spherical shell morphology was clearly observed (upper panels).…”

“…In China, it is used as a folk medicine for treating acute and chronic hepatitis, jaundice, rheumatism and removing the liver toxicants [1][2]. In previous studies, A. cantoniensis was reportedly showed potential biological activities including antioxidant [2][3][4], anti-tumor [5][6], immunoregulatory activity [5] and wound healing activity [7]. Some chemical constituents have been isolated from A. cantoniensis, such as triterpenes, thraquinones, flavonoids, and alkaloids [8][9][10][11], while isoflavones have never been reported in this plant.…”
